Impact of Atomization Inhalation Combined with Individualized Pulmonary Rehabilitation Training on Pulmonary Function of Patients with COPD Complicated with Respiratory Failure
Objective To analyze the effect of atomization inhalation combined with individualized pulmonary rehabilitation training applied in patients with chronic obstructive pulmonary disease(COPD)complicated with respiratory failure.Methods 86 patients with COPD complicated with respiratory failure were randomly divided into two groups.The control group received atomization inhalation,and the observation group received individualized pulmonary rehabilitation training on the basis of the control group.The pulmonary function and blood gas analysis indicators were compared between the two groups.Results After nursing,FVC,FEV1 and FEV1/FVC in the observation group were higher than those in the control group(P<0.05).After nursing,PaO2 and SpO2 in the observation group were higher than those in the control group,and PaCO2 was lower than that in the control group(P<0.05).Conclusions Atomization inhalation combined with individualized pulmonary rehabilitation training applied in patients with COPD complicated with respiratory failure has significant effect,which can improve the pulmonary function of patients and accelerate the normalization of blood gas analysis indicators.
